You are on page 1of 3

Yêu cầu cho bài Lab 2

1. Tạo 2 bảng
Đề 1:

a. Staff có các trường (cột) sau


- Staff_ID (Integer)
- Staff_Name nchar (100)
- Address nchar(500)
- Department_ID (Integer)

b. Department
- Department_ID (Integer)
- Department_Name nchar (100)
- Phone nchar (15)
Đề 2:

a. Course có các trường (cột) sau


- Course_ID (Integer)
- Course_Name nchar (100)
- Unit (Integer)
- Program_ID (Integer)

b. Program
- Program_ID (Integer)
- Program_Name nchar (100)
- Department nchar (150)

Đề 3:

c. BusinessUnit có các trường (cột) sau


- BusinessUnit_ID (Integer)
- BusinessUnit_Name nchar (100)
- Address nchar(500)
- Organization_ID (Integer)

d. Organization
- Organization_ID (Integer)
- Organization_Name nchar (100)
- CEO_Name nchar (150)

Yêu cầu

1. Viết các câu lệnh insert dữ liệu sau vào các bảng
a. Đề 1
Bảng Staff

Staff_ID Staff_Name Address Department_ID


1 Nguyen Van Hung Hang Bun, Ha 1
Noi
2 Nguyen Van Thang Cau giay, Ha Noi 2

Bảng Department

Department_I Department_Name Phone


D
1 Bán Hàng 0982346712
2 Tiếp thị 0972346712

b. Đề 2
Bảng Course

Course_ID Course_Name Unit Program_ID


1 Java Core 3 1
2 Marketing 4 2

Bảng Program

Program_ID Program_Name Department


1 Software Engineering IT
2 Business Administration Business

c. Đề 3

Bảng BusinessUnit

BusinessUnit_I BusinessUnit_Name Address Organization_ID


D
1 Marketing Hang Bun, Ha 1
Noi
2 Sale Cau giay, Ha Noi 2

Bảng Organization

Organization_ID Organization_Name CEO_name


1 FPT University Nguyễn Khắc Thành
2 FPT Software Nguyễn Việt Anh
2. Viết các câu lệnh select dữ liệu từ các bảng theo yêu cầu sau
a. Viết câu lệnh SQL để liệt kê dữ liệu các bảng Staff, Course, BusinessUnit với điều kiện giá
trị ở cột ID = 1
b. Viết câu lệnh SQL để liệt kê dữ liệu các bảng Department, Program, Organization với
điều kiện giá trị ở cột ID = 2

3. Viết các câu lệnh update dữ liệu cho dòng có ID có giá trị = 1
Đề a
Update trường Staff_Name = ‘New Staff’

Đề b

Update trường Course_Name = ‘Administration’

Đề c

Update trường BusinessUnit _Name = ‘Shiping’

4. Vẽ sơ đồ ERD thể hiện quan hệ giữa các thực thể

You might also like